REDWOOD CITY, Calif.--()--Openwave Systems Inc. (Nasdaq:OPWV), a global software innovator delivering context-aware mediation and messaging solutions that enable communication service providers and the broader ecosystem to create and deliver smarter services, today announced that Kansai Multimedia Service Company (KMS), the provider in the Kansai area of cable internet services under the “ZAQ” brand for Jupiter Telecommunications Co. Ltd. (J:COM), the largest multi-system operator (MSO) in Japan, has selected a suite of Openwave’s infrastructure and email solutions that include Openwave® RichMail and Openwave® Email Mx supported by Openwave professional services.

“The goal of KMS is to deliver to our subscribers highly reliable and engaging services – not available through other ISPs –without compromising security and value,” said Tadashi Hara, President of KMS. “We concluded that Openwave’s messaging suite was the most suitable to achieve this goal.”
The messaging solution selected by KMS includes Openwave RichMail, an AJAX-based converged communications solution that offers the end user a web-based means for accessing the mailbox wherever and whenever it’s needed, and Openwave Email Mx, an extensible, carrier-scale email solution that scales to support any number of subscribers with fast, reliable performance. Openwave’s infrastructure and email solutions eliminate the need for KMS to deal with multiple vendors and multiple modules, providing a consolidated end-to-end platform that includes a back end message store, anti-abuse solutions and web access for end users. The flexible, extensible and highly scalable IPv6 compliant platforms are expected to allow in the future the rapid deployment of customized solutions including new revenue-generating services that are capable of handling millions of subscribers and large-capacity mailbox storage. In addition, the Openwave solution provides KMS with the foundation needed to deploy disaster-recovery solutions in the future.

About Kansai Multimedia Service Company (KMS)
KMS has partnered with 25 cable operators in five prefectures in Kansai to provide cable internet services under the ZAQ brand. It has 570,000 household subscribers as of Oct. 2009. For more information please visit www.kmsc.co.jp.
